Wal-Mart picks WestJet
http://www.canada.com/montrealgazett...f8d41e&k=57801
One up for Air Canada's rival WestJet. The low-cost airline said today it will be Wal-Mart Stores Inc.'s preferred Canadian carrier. That means WestJet provides transportation services to all the giant retailer's business travellers in Canada and crossborder. |
